Nvidia Corp. invests in Mistral AI SAS
Funding Provisional 78% confidence first seen
Mistral AI SAS raised about €3 billion in a Series D funding round, valuing the company at more than €21 billion post-money. The round was led by Samsung Electronics and included Nvidia Corp. among more than two dozen participating backers. The investment is reported in connection with Mistral’s plan to expand AI training compute and infrastructure and accelerate international growth, supporting its sovereign, open-weight AI strategy.

Decision brief
- What changed
- Mistral AI closed a €3 billion Series D funding round at a post-money valuation above €21 billion, with Samsung Electronics leading and Nvidia participating among more than two dozen investors. The company said the capital will be used to buy computing infrastructure for AI training and support international expansion.
- Why it matters
- For business leaders evaluating AI suppliers, this financing indicates Mistral now has substantially more capital to expand training capacity and global operations, which could strengthen it as an alternative model provider. Nvidia’s participation also matters because it aligns a major AI hardware ecosystem player with Mistral, although the coverage only directly supports that Nvidia joined the round, not any commercial commitments beyond the investment.
- Evidence
- SiliconANGLE reported that Mistral closed a €3 billion round led by Samsung Electronics, with funds earmarked for AI training infrastructure and international expansion. The provided coverage is a single article, so support for the event details is limited to one outlet rather than multiple independent confirmations.
- What remains uncertain
- The coverage does not disclose Nvidia’s investment size, any board or governance rights, or whether the deal includes preferred access to GPUs, cloud capacity, or joint go-to-market arrangements. It also does not verify how quickly Mistral can convert new capital into usable compute capacity or how its stated sovereign, open-weight strategy will translate into enterprise offerings.
- Monitor next
- Watch for Mistral to announce specific infrastructure purchases, cloud or datacenter partnerships, and new country launches that show how the €3 billion is being deployed.
